Imposition of duty on Russian coal postponed until May 1

Ukrinform
The Government of Ukraine has postponed the imposition of duty on coal from the Russian Federation until May 1.

"To impose from May 1," Prime Minister of Ukraine Denys Shmyhal said at the Cabinet’s meeting, an Ukrinform correspondent reports.

According to Economic Development, Trade and Agriculture Minister of Ukraine Ihor Petrashko, the list of coal types on which the duty will be imposed is going to be amended.

On March 18, the Cabinet of Ministers of Ukraine adopted a resolution on imposition of a special duty on Russian electricity and coal, except for anthracite and metallurgical coal, from April 1, 2020.

Subsequently, the resolution was amended and the imposition of duty was postponed until 15 April.
